Ependion AB Receivables Turnover Calculation

Receivables Turnover measures the number of times a company collects its average accounts receivable balance.

Ependion AB's Receivables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Receivables Turnover (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Revenue / Average Accounts Receivable
=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 ) / ((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count )
=2231.753 / ((381.599 + 376.8) / 2 )
=2231.753 / 379.1995
=5.89

Ependion AB's Receivables Turnover for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Receivables Turnover (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=Revenue / Average Accounts Receivable
=Revenue (Q: Jun. 2026 ) / ((Accounts Receivable (Q: Mar. 2026 ) + Accounts Receivable (Q: Jun. 2026 )) / count )
=681.978 / ((427.024 + 485.095) / 2 )
=681.978 / 456.0595
=1.50

Ependion AB Business Description

Address Stora Varvsgatan 13A, Box 426, Malmo, SWE, SE-201 24
Ependion AB is technology group delivering digital solutions for secure control, visualization and data communication for industrial applications in environments where reliability and high quality are critical factors. The operating segments are divided between the Beijer Electronics and Westermo business entities. Beijer; and Westermo. It generates majority of revenue from Westermo which develops robust and secure communication solutions for harsh environments, with its focus on rail networks, with the business entity being the world'wide market leader in its niche for trackside and for the energy sector. The company has presence in Nordics, Rest of Europe, North America, Asia, and Rest of world.
